WAUPACA COUNTY POST
May 19, 1921
OLSON AND MONROE BUY BARBER SHOP OF A.F. LARSON, EAST MAIN STREET.
Negotiations were consummated on Friday by which Leland Olson and Joe Monroe became owners of the Andrew Larson tonsorial parlor on East side of Main Street this city.
Mr. Larson has been actively engaged in this city over thirty years and is giving up work under compulsion having been afflicted with a severe attack of lumbago and rheumatism.
Both Mr. Olson and Mr. Monroe are well and favorably known in this city and are experienced in their vocation and will keep the shop up to the high standard which it has enjoyed under the efficient management of the retiring proprietor.
